SME Market Focus Capitalise's core customer base consists of UK small and medium-sized enterprises seeking improved access to funding and credit insights, indicating a significant opportunity to target financial advisors and accounting firms that serve this segment.
Partnership Expansion The company has established strategic partnerships with notable organizations such as FSB, Funding Circle, and Facebook, which presents opportunities to expand collaborative offerings and reach wider SME audiences through joint marketing efforts.
Technology Integration Utilizing a modern tech stack including React, MongoDB, and TypeScript, Capitalise’s platform is well-positioned to integrate additional financial and credit products, enabling cross-selling of complementary solutions like credit risk management and cash flow monitoring tools.
Funding and Growth With $18 million in funding and a revenue range of up to $50 million, Capitalise is in a growth phase that supports the development of new features and customer acquisition initiatives targeting advisors and lenders in the SME finance space.
Service Diversification Recent product launches such as the Credit Risk Manager and collaborations with banks and fintech partners suggest an expansion into broader financial services, providing opportunities to promote additional modules and automated credit assessment services to financial professionals.
